Captain Woolf Barnato with his Bentley
Captain Woolf Barnato with his Speed Six Bentley fitted with a racing body. Woolf Barnato had just beaten the Blue Train from Monte Carlo to Calais in this (or similar) car. This body is only one if its kind, built by Gurney Nutting. The car still exists

EDITORS COMMENTS
This print captures the legendary Captain Woolf Barnato posing proudly with his iconic Speed Six Bentley, fitted with a unique racing body crafted by Gurney Nutting. The image immortalizes a historic moment in June 1930 when Barnato triumphantly beat the Blue Train from Monte Carlo to Calais in this very car.
The sleek design of the Bentley exudes power and sophistication, reflecting Barnato's status as a daring and accomplished racer. This particular body is one-of-a-kind, showcasing the craftsmanship and attention to detail that went into its creation.
As an import figure in automotive history, Captain Woolf Barnato's legacy lives on through this remarkable vehicle. The fact that this car still exists today is a testament to its enduring significance and the passion of collectors who preserve such treasures.
